Our episode starts off with Vandal Savage questioning Rip Hunter after Rip’s first attempt to kill Savage way back in 1700 BCE in Ancient Egypt.  Savage taunts Hunter, and Rip stays heroic.

Back on the ship in the present time (sorta), the crew is celebrating a mission almost accomplished as they have captured Savage. Captain Cold is really angry  that they haven’t killed savage.  The Atom has discovered that Savage is using tech from the future even further ahead than 2166, which is against the rules the Time Masters play by. Rip decided to take them to the Vanishing Point to turn Savage in.

Savage and Hunter have another conversation, this time with Hunter as jailer and Savage as prisoner.  When confronted about the far-future tech, Savage says that he learned to time travel from Rip.  Savage talks of his kids who have died and how he plays a deep game.  Hunter just calls him a fascist.

Hawkgirl and Atom try and convince a brainwashed Carter Hall that he’s, y’know, Carter Hall.  Carter holds tightly to his new identity, and says he knows all about Hawkgirl because he has been told about his enemies by Savage.

White Canary and Rip have a conversation in which we learn that the ship is in bad shape due to Savage’s last attack.  Canary also points out that when they brought Savage on board that the timeline where he kills Rip’s kids didn’t change.  Hunter seems shaken.  The ship is literally shaking, but Rip seems to think that it will stay together.  Of course, then it fails.

The time drive seems to be out.  Stein worries about being stuck in the middle of the time stream.  Rip sends Jax to fix the time drive while telling Stein that there is a jump ship with the ability to do one final jump to 2016.  Canary goes to guard Savage who goads her and says Hunter picked them all because they are easy to manipulate.  Canary blows it off.

Jax finds a giant crack in the time drive.  As he works on it, Stein and Rip note that he is being irradiated.  Rip seems blase about this, and of course, then it sorta blows up on Jax.  Jax winds up having a neat flashback about his Mom giving him a watch meant for his Dad.  When Jax comes to, he is being carried by Stein and Rip and we learn that Jax was exposed to a great deal of temporal radiation; Gideon says it’s affecting his body by aging him, and there’s nothing Gideon can do.

The Rogues are chatting, and Cold says he has a sixth sense about this job.  It feels bad to him, so they want out.

DC's Legends of Tomorrow --"River of Time"-- Image LGN114b_0047b.jpg -- Pictured (L-R): Wentworth Miller as Leonard Snart/Captain Cold, Ciara Renee as Kendra Saunders/Hawkgirl, Dominic Purcell as Mick Rory/Heat Wave and Brandon Routh as Ray Palmer/Atom -- Photo: Diyah Pera/The CW -- © 2016 The CW Network, LLC. All Rights Reserved.

Rip forcefully tells Gideon to reboot, and he seems obsessed with the fact that the timeline hasn’t changed in regard to his family dying.  Canary tells Hunter about what Savage said about him, and Hunter denies little of it and says he just isn’t sure about himself.

In another attempt to get Carter’s mind right again, Hawkgirl shows him a picture of their son, but she gets too close and Carter almost kills her.  Atom steps in, saves her, and then says to stay away from Carter as he goes to chat with Savage about Carter’s mind.  Savage once again goads Atom.  He informs Atom that he, too, used to love Hawkgirl, and that Carter had ruined that for him as well.  Savage tries to convince Atom that they are on the same side, but Atom is having none of it.  Instead, he has a flashback about the last time he and Felicity Smoak talked before he left for the future fight.

Atom returns to see Hawkgirl reading a LOVE POEM to Carter.  They have the same conversation they have been having for several episodes now about destiny and love and all that jazz, but this time, Atom breaks up with her.  Hawkgirl doesn’t really try and stop him from leaving, although she does seem a little sad.

Jax has aged to 63, and The Rogues are mad.  They point out that not killing Savage is why this has happened.  They confront Rip about what happened, and how it’s his fault.  He tells them to leave in the time ship if they have no faith.  White Canary joins the conversation, and we see her have a flashback with Nyssa Al Ghul.  Ghul is in captivity, and this is the first time she has seen Canary since Canary died and got better.  Nyssa is facing a punishment with dignity, and she insists that Canary not free her.

Back on the ship, Stein goes to see Savage to try and use the ritual with Carter’s body in 1975 to save Jax.  Savage tries to manipulate Stein, but he basically just figures out that he can save Jax by sending him back to 2016.  He once again slips Jax a roofie (why is this his thing?) and puts him on the jump ship home to 2016.  Seems like he could have asked if anyone else wanted to go before just shuttling Jax home.  The Rogues show up and, well, they sorta wanted to be on it!  The Rogues threaten Stein, but he points out they all have to work together now.

DC's Legends of Tomorrow --"River of Time"-- Image LGN114b_0260b.jpg -- Pictured (L-R): Dominic Purcell as Mick Rory/Heat Wave and Wentworth Miller as Leonard Snart/Captain Cold -- Photo: Diyah Pera/The CW -- © 2016 The CW Network, LLC. All Rights Reserved.

Atom goes to talk to Savage again, and they argue about Hawkgirl.  Savage goads Atom into opening the cell, and while Atom gets a few good blows in, Savage basically whoops him good.  For a genius, the Atom is an idiot.  Savage gets loose, leaves Atom behind, and then shuts Gideon down.  Atom recovers, and he teams up with Captain Cold and Heat Wave in a futile effort to stop Savage.  Hunter instructs Canary and Stein on how to operate the ship.  Canary starts out navigating, but she winds up piloting when Hunter leaves to go help the others deal with Savage.  Hunter gets taken out fairly quickly in the fight, but just as Savage is about to kill Hawkgirl, Carter remembers that he is Hawkman!  His wings sprout and he goes at Savage until he gets shanked right in the gut!

DC's Legends of Tomorrow --"River of Time"-- Image LGN114b_0363b.jpg -- Pictured (L-R): Casper Crump as Vandal Savage, Ciara Renee as Kendra Saunders/Hawkgirl and Falk Hentschel as Hawkman/Carter Hall -- Photo: Diyah Pera/The CW -- © 2016 The CW Network, LLC. All Rights Reserved.

This enrages Hawkgirl who then musters up all her strength and knocks Savage out!  This all occurs just as they make it to the Vanishing Point, where they are hauled in with a tractor beam.

Atom and Hawkgirl have what is hopefully their last chat about their relationship.  Hawkgirl is sorry it isn’t gonna work out.  They both wish things could be different, and then Atom thanks her because that’s what sappy guys like Atom do.

Rip calls an emergency session of the council where he proves that Savage has been manipulating the timestream.  Of course, it turns out that the council knew it all along, as they are in cahoots.  The show ends with the crew being taken captive, and Savage goading Hunter in a jail cell now.  I wonder why Savage tried so hard to escape if he knew that they were just taking him to all his allies?  Oh well.  Savage tells Hunter on the way out that he’s ready to meet his family. Things don’t look good for the kids right now.

